Description[]

Gneiss (pronounced "Nice") is an orangeish-tan rock that spawns in ores between Y=5 and Y=112. It can be crafted into a block literally called Gneiss.

The ore is affected by the Fortune enchantment.

Uses[]

Oddly enough, Gneiss is a very dangerous material once crafted into a block or found otherwise. When broken, it drops itself, but also spawns a lava source in the space it was occupying, potentially giving it a use as more than a simple decoration block. Do note that the block *may* only drop when using Silk Touch, this has not been confirmed.

Antlion Overlord Pyramids[]

Gneiss is found in far more extravagant variants within Antlion Overlord Pyramids. It still retains its lava-producing effect, which prevents players from simply mining through the mazes. However, these variants can also be obtained, namely;

  • Carved Gneiss
  • Layered Gneiss
  • Gneiss Brick
  • Smooth Gneiss
  • Gneiss Tiles
  • Gneiss Gas Vents aka Cracked Gneiss

None of these variants can be crafted as of yet, and the Gas Vent variants will still produce flame pillars on occasion, so best be careful. It is possible to obtain these if they drop at an angle that throws them away from the lava produced by breaking them; this writer has obtained several using this method, however it is very hit-and-miss.
